According to CoS, Kanye West‘s follow-up to 2008’s 808s and Heartbreak has been delayed another month, to October 12th. However, according to Kanye West himself, via his recent Ustream video-chat with the general public, he announced that his new album would be out sometime in November. He went on to talk about how much he likes Thom Yorke and Trent Reznor for their ability to bring lyrical abstraction to mass audience. Check out the video feed here.
